The most significant advantage of 4G Public Network PoC Walkie-Talkie lies in its unparalleled coverage. Traditional analog or digital walkie-talkies are limited by base station height, terrain obstruction, and transmission power, often restricting communication distance to within line-of-sight; once outside this range, the signal is interrupted. In contrast, PoC walkie-talkies directly utilize the mature 4G public mobile network for data transmission, enabling clear and smooth voice communication wherever there is a mobile signal. Whether navigating urban canyons lined with skyscrapers, traversing vast rural highways, or undertaking long-distance transport across provinces and cities, users can stay connected anytime, anywhere. This "nearby" communication capability significantly improves the efficiency of cross-regional collaboration, allowing command centers to monitor the real-time dynamics of terminals scattered across various locations, achieving true flattened command and dispatch.
Beyond overcoming distance limitations, rich multimedia functions are another highlight of 4G POC walkie-talkies. Leveraging the high bandwidth of 4G networks, modern POC walkie-talkies are no longer limited to simple voice transmission but integrate various intelligent applications such as high-definition video calls, real-time positioning, image transmission, and group management. At the scene of an emergency, frontline personnel can directly transmit on-site video back to the command center, allowing decision-makers to have a "virtual" understanding of the situation's development and make more accurate and scientific judgments. The built-in high-precision BeiDou or GPS positioning module can upload personnel location information in real time and display it intuitively on an electronic map, facilitating track playback, area fencing, and emergency rescue dispatch for managers. This multi-dimensional information interaction capability upgrades simple voice intercom into a comprehensive visual command system, significantly improving the speed and quality of emergency response.
Cost-effectiveness and ease of deployment are also key reasons why 4G POC walkie-talkies are so popular. Traditional professional wireless communication systems require self-built base stations, dedicated lines, and applications for dedicated frequencies, resulting in huge initial investments and complex maintenance. In contrast, 4G POC walkie-talkies require no infrastructure construction and can quickly form a network using existing public network resources. Users only need to insert an IoT SIM card, power on the device, and log in to the platform to communicate, greatly reducing network construction costs and barriers to entry. Simultaneously, the cloud platform architecture makes group management exceptionally flexible. Administrators can create, modify, or delete call groups at any time through the backend software, without the need for cumbersome physical frequency programming operations on terminal devices. This on-demand allocation and flexible expansion model perfectly adapts to the needs of frequent changes in modern enterprise organizational structures and the formation of temporary task groups.
In terms of hardware design and durability, professional 4G POC walkie-talkies maintain stringent industrial-grade standards. Despite integrating complex intelligent modules, its casing is typically made of high-strength engineering plastics or metal, offering excellent dustproof, waterproof, and drop-resistant performance, enabling it to withstand various harsh operating environments such as high temperatures, extreme cold, and humidity. A large-capacity battery, combined with intelligent power-saving strategies, ensures the device's endurance during long standby periods and high-frequency use. The physical button design retains the traditional "one-button" operation of walkie-talkies, allowing users to quickly initiate calls even while wearing gloves or in emergencies, ensuring reliable and timely communication.
